Alaska Food Co is looking for a proactive, highly-organized, and tech-savvy Executive Assistant to support our executives in managing the day-to-day flow of communication, appointments, files, and systems. This role involves managing a diverse range of administrative, project-based, and operational tasks to ensure the smooth functioning of both leaders schedules and initiatives. The ideal candidate will be proficient in Google Workspace, with excellent communication skills, a keen eye for detail, and a strong commitment to confidentiality. This is a hybrid position for the right person. We need someone who can take a mess and make it functional with minimal direction. Key Responsibilities
Calendar & Scheduling Management: Maintain and coordinate separate calendars for the Founders and CEO, scheduling meetings, appointments, and events while sending timely reminders. Email Support: Manage and prioritize emails for both the Founders and CEO, draft responses, and handle correspondence efficiently. Project-Based Work: Assist with various projects, conduct research, prepare reports, and follow up to ensure timely completion. File & Photo Organization: Maintain organized digital filing systems for documents and photos, ensuring easy access and retrieval. Template Creation & System Development: Develop templates for emails, reports, and workflows; establish efficient systems to streamline daily operations. Communication & Liaison: Act as a point of contact between the Founders, CEO, and internal/external stakeholders. Administrative Support: Handle miscellaneous tasks such as travel arrangements, expense reports, and managing office supplies if needed. Confidentiality: Handle sensitive information with discretion and maintain strict confidentiality at all times. Qualifications
